Sweden's September 13 parliamentary election produced a narrow centre-left lead in preliminary results, with the Social Democrats at roughly 28 percent, Moderates near 20 percent, and Sweden Democrats at about 17.6 percent. The four-party left bloc projects to around 176 seats and the right-wing Tidö-aligned parties to 173 in the 349-seat Riksdag, pending final counts of postal and overseas ballots. All eight established parties cleared or approached the 4 percent threshold required for seats under proportional representation, though the Liberals' position near that line created the main uncertainty for representation. Coalition talks have begun, with seat allocation hinging on the final verified tallies expected within days.

Each market will resolve to "Yes" if the specified party receives at least one seat in the Swedish Riksdag as a result of the 2026 Swedish parliamentary elections. Otherwise that market will resolve to "No".
Seats will be counted only where they are attributed to the specified party. Seats attributed to another party or electoral designation will not count, regardless of electoral cooperation, endorsements, coalition agreements, or subsequent parliamentary-group arrangements. If the specified party formally merges into a successor party before the election and does not contest separately, seats officially attributed to that successor party will count.
If the results of this election are not definitively known by December 31, 2026, 11:59 PM ET, each market will resolve to "No".
Each market's resolution will be based solely on the number of seats won by the specified party in this election.
This market will resolve based on the results of this election as indicated by a consensus of credible reporting. If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ve based solely on the official results as reported by the Swedish government, specifically the Swedish Election Authority (Valmyndigheten) (https://www.val.se/).
